U.S. 1881 Mounted Engineer Officer's Helmet, adapted in 1881 and based on the early 1872 Cavalry pattern. The date 1881 marked a distinct shift in American military attire. U.S. Army adopted Prussian patterns instead of French designs. U.S. military lost its interest in things French following their poor showing in the Franco-Prussian War of 1870-71. Horsehead mane indicates mounted service. The castle motif and button indicates this hat belonged to a Mounted Engineer. Helmet is high grade black wool over cork with stamped brass fitting and hardware, with crimson horsehair mane. Used from 1881 to 1902. Condition is excellent with light checking to the brim edge. Sweatband shows minor losses. Maker's label is missing. Braid appears to be of later mfg. Est.: $300-$600.
